#bdf6cc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#bdf6cc is composed of 74.1% red, 96.5% green and 80%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 23.2% cyan, 0% magenta, 17.1% yellow and 3.5% black. It has a hue angle of 135.8 degrees, a saturation of 76% and a lightness of 85.3%. #bdf6cc color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#7bed99. Closest websafe color is: #ccffcc.

● #bdf6cc color description : Very soft cyan - lime green.
#bdf6cc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#bdf6cc has RGB values of R:189, G:246, B:204 and CMYK values of C:0.23, M:0, Y:0.17, K:0.04. Its decimal value is 12449484.
